Looking for Ways to Build Credit? Simply Pay Rent Online

If you aren’t paying your rent online, then you are doing it wrong. Paying rent online has so many benefits, including improving your overall credit score. TransUnion studied 12,000 renters who reported their rent payments to credit bureaus over the course of a year. The study found that the credit scores rose 16 points within six months on average. Those who started with a credit score below 620 saw the most significant impact!

If you are looking to increase your credit score, pay your rent online so that your payments are reported and build a consistent payment history. For an extra boost, pay with a credit card, and you will see positive results in no time!

Build a Payment History

Paying rent online is great, but you have to be consistent if you want to see improvements in your credit score. According to Experian, credit scores are determined through the following elements :

  • Use of credit cards
  • Payment history
  • Applications for new loans and credit

When you pay rent online, those payments become part of your payment history. As you continue to pay on time and in full, your credit score can increase.

Pay with a Credit Card for Higher Score Gains

While not a deal-breaker if you don’t, paying your rent online with a credit card will give your score an extra boost. If you are struggling to improve your score, or if your score is lower than average, we suggest using a credit card for your online rent payments.

LaToya Irby, credit expert for The Balance, recommends this as well. “Open a credit card and use it to pay your rent . . . then pay your credit card balance in full each month,” says Irby. “The timely credit card payments will help boost your credit score.”
